Rosie is a good dog and a faithful companion to her owner, George. She likes taking walks with George and looking at the clouds together, but the closest she comes to another dog is when she encounters her reflection in her empty dog bowl, and sometimes that makes Rosie feel lonely. A young witch is determined to teach her baby sister about humans and the mysterious things they do on Halloween, like trick-or-treating. The little witchling surprises her older sister by getting lots of candy on Halloween. However, when they try to get back home on their broom, the load is too heavy and the little witchling will have to make a choice.
